Latest Patents

Among Cardinal's most recent innovations is the patent for a "System and method for preventing catastrophic damage in drivetrain of a wind turbine." This technology involves a comprehensive method for monitoring and controlling the drivetrain's performance. The method utilizes a controller to receive speed measurements from the generator and estimate mechanical torque, facilitating preventive actions when conditions exceed safe thresholds.

Another groundbreaking patent is the "System and method for controlling a pitch angle of a wind turbine rotor blade." This invention introduces a sophisticated system that adjusts the pitch angle of the rotor blade based on wind asymmetry parameters and wear factors derived from the turbine's operational data. This feature enhances the turbine's efficiency and prolongs the lifespan of its components.
